In a bowl add the chicken with the garam masala, cumin, turmeric, garlic powder, ginger, red chili powder and buttermilk. Mix it, then cover with cling film and chill in fridge for 1 hour
In a non-stick pan, add the extra virgin olive oil on high heat. Add each chicken piece and cook for 4 minutes on each side until slightly browned. Keep the remaining marinade sauce for later. The chicken will not be thoroughly cooked at this point
2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
Remove the chicken from pan and set aside
In the same pan, add the butter and onions. Cook until soft and golden brown, for about 7 minutes on medium heat
1 tablespoon salted butter, 1 large onion
Add the tomato sauce, juice of lime and bring to simmer.
15 ounces tomato sauce, Juice from 1 lime
Add the marinade sauce and cook for another 5 minutes
Add the chicken in and let everything cook on medium heat for 15-20 minutes, until chicken is thoroughly cooked
Add the heavy cream stir everything together and cook for another 5 minutes on low heat
1½ cups heavy cream
Serve over steamed rice, add some fresh coriander to taste and enjoy!
Fresh coriander to taste

Notes
Some separating may occur when adding the buttermilk marinade to the sauce, but it won't affect taste.
